Movements of the ankle?

The ankle joint can perform various movements, including plantarflexion (pointing the foot downwards), dorsiflexion (bringing the foot up towards the shin), inversion (turning the sole of the foot inwards), and eversion (turning the sole of the foot outwards). These movements are essential for walking, running, and maintaining balance. Strengthening and stretching exercises can help improve the ankle's range of motion and stability.

How can I improve my technique for foot paddling in a kayak?

To improve your foot paddling technique in a kayak, focus on keeping your feet relaxed and using your leg muscles to push and pull the foot pedals smoothly. Practice proper foot positioning and make sure your feet are securely in contact with the pedals. Additionally, work on coordinating your foot movements with your paddle strokes to maximize efficiency and power. Regular practice and feedback from experienced kayakers can also help refine your technique.

How can consuming more liquid help improve bowel movements?

Consuming more liquid can help improve bowel movements by softening stool, making it easier to pass through the digestive system. This can prevent constipation and promote regularity in bowel movements.
